I have a Marantz SR7200, which is Dolby EX or DTS ES capable (Matrixed only). The issue is when the system is in Auto mode it will not detect EX or ES encoded material and the rear centre channel is dormant. In order to utilise the rear centre channel you have to force the system into 6.1ch surround mode.

That’s fine except when in this mode the audio for the DVD software menus is muted as 6.1ch surround mode will only utilise 5.1 digital data (or better). i.e. if the DVD software menu sound set-up is in stereo or Dolby pro logic the 6.1ch surround mode will not decode this data. The other pain is if I put in a CD and listen to it on the DVD I have to constantly change the surround sound mode from 6.1ch surround to Auto or stereo so I can hear something. Similarly if I am in source direct the system will only operate in Auto mode therefore no sound from the rear centre even if it is EX or ES encoded.

Am I doing something wrong or is this just how this receiver operates. If this is the case then the receiver isn’t detecting the EX or ES flags so is the 6.1ch surround mode decoding the rear centre data correctly?

This receiver IS capable of both matrix and EX/ES decoding and reproduction, as stated by Marantz. The provided sixth channel is powered, and properly decoded.

This is an obvious one, but you have to select EX/ES from the menu on the disc. In auto, it may or may not pick it up. 6ch is NOT EX/ES, that is matrixed. I usually force TS or DD when listening to a disc with that type of track.

Try - T2: Ultimate Edition, Toy Story II, Gladiator, Superspeedway:Mach II, etc... I got plenty of rear center with these on my 6200

I always make sure I select the correct audio set-up on the DVD software. Region 4 DVDs such as Star Wars: Episode 1 and Exorcist (25 Annversiary) only have Dolby Digital EX sound tracks so the correct signal should be automatically sent to the receiver anyway. The SR7200 definitely works well in 6.1 mode as the EX DVDs I have tried really make good use of the rear centre.

What annoys me is that in AUTO mode on the receiver it still will not decode into 6.1 even with the EX setting selected on the DVD software. For me to get it to work I have to force the receiver into 6.1ch channel mode. What I want to know is that how the receiver works, because my brothers Yamaha automatically will detect EX/ES stuff and decode it appropriately.

Another note when in 6.1ch channel mode are your DVD software menus muted?

Yes, the menus are muted when you force DTS/6.1, because they are usually some form of DD, often 2.0.

I suppose the Auto detect doesn't know the difference when it sees EX/ES and is defaulting to a 5.1 format first.
